Comparison review

The Sony Xperia XZ2 Premium has a general score of 82.2, which is a little bit better than the LG G7 ThinQ's overall score of 81. Although Sony Xperia XZ2 Premium is a better phone than LG G7 ThinQ, it must be told that it is also a thicker and notably heavier phone. The Sony Xperia XZ2 Premium features just a bit better looking screen than LG G7 ThinQ, because although it has a little darker screen and a little bit smaller display, it also counts with a higher 2160 x 3840 pixels resolution and a higher display pixel density.

The Xperia XZ2 Premium features a bit better CPU than LG G7 ThinQ, and although they both have the same number of cores, the Xperia XZ2 Premium also has 2 GB more RAM. The Xperia XZ2 Premium features just a bit better camera than LG G7 ThinQ, because although it has lower video frame rates and a smaller camera aperture which is not recommended for low-light captures and video, and they both have the same 3840x2160 video resolution, the Xperia XZ2 Premium also counts with a lot bigger back camera sensor which provides a much higher image and video quality and a back camera with a better resolution.

LG G7 ThinQ has a lot bigger storage for games and applications than Xperia XZ2 Premium, and although they both have equal internal storage, the LG G7 ThinQ also has an external memory slot that admits a maximum of 1,95 TB. The Xperia XZ2 Premium features longer battery lifetime than LG G7 ThinQ, because it has 3540mAh of battery capacity.

Although Xperia XZ2 Premium is a better device, it costs a lot more than LG G7 ThinQ, and it doesn't have such a good price and quality relation as LG G7 ThinQ. So if you need that extra specs and features, you can buy Xperia XZ2 Premium, otherwise you can save a couple dollars and get the LG G7 ThinQ, giving up some features and specs.
